Shawnee News-Star
Wednesday May 12, 1943 page 8

Murphy Services Will Be Today

Funeral services will be held at 4 p.m. today in the Church of Christ for Pleasant William Murphy, 88, retired painter who died at 10:40 p.m. Monday at a local hospital.

Brother Perry B. Cotham, minister of the Church of Christ at Wewoka, will officiate and burial will be in Fairview cemetery. Rocesch Brothers are in charge. Bearers will be W. T. Brown, Leroy Flinchum, W. B. Cox, W. A. Thompson and Lawrence McGee.

Murphy, a member of the Church of Christ, has lived in this community since 1901, coming here from Collin county, Texas. He had been living at the home of a daughter, Mrs. Sam J Gardner, 510 North Louisa street.

Survivors include a son, P. B. Murphy, Oakland, Calif.; five daughters, Mrs. Gardner, Mrs. Joe Lane and Mrs. G. B. Betts, all of Shawnee, Mrs. C. C. Markham, McLoud, and Mrs. C. C. Ratliff, Chicago, Ill., 18 grandchildren and 12 great-grandchildren.

bullet  Noted events in his life were:

• Census, 1860, Precinct 4, Collin, Texas. 6

• Census, 1870, Precinct 5, Collin, Texas. 7 He was a farm laborer.

• Census, 1880, Precinct 5, Collin, Texas. 4 He was a farmer.

• Census, 1900, Precint 5, Collin, Texas. 1 He was a farmer, owned his farm but it was mortgaged.

• Moved, 1901, Shawnee, Pottawatomie, Oklahoma, USA. 5,8 The Murphy family came to Oklahoma from Collin county, Texas. They lived on a farm north of Shawnee for several years.

• Census, 1910, 2-wd Shawnee, Pottawatomie, Oklahoma. 9 He was a Blacksmith for the Rail Road Shop. It shows he was a widower.

• Census, 1920, Precint 2, Shawnee, Pottawatomie, Oklahoma. 10 He was a Public Laborer.

• Census, 1930, Ward 1, Shawnee, Pottawatomie, Oklahoma. 11 He is living with his daughter Cleda & her family. He is retired at this time.

• Residence, Bef 12 May 1943, Shawnee, Pottawatomie, Oklahoma, USA. 5 He was living at his daughter Winnie Lee (Murphy) Gardner house before his death.
